Green products from waste matter go mainstream

For this local company, it is easy being green. Award-winning industrial firm Plantex (from the words “plant” and “extract”) shows that beyond income generation, choosing to be green can also be an advocacy that has the power to preserve nature and better the lives of people at the same time.

Having grown from backyard operations in 2003, Plantex Solutions Manufacturing Corp.’s household and homecare products are derived from indigenous materials ordinarily regarded as “waste” like overripe fruits and vegetables, as well as banana trunks, bark, and peelings.
